The NC State football season opener for 2023 is at Connecticut on Aug. 31 — or 94 days away. TheWolfpacker.com’s countdown for the season looks at the significance of the number 94 in Pack history.
NC State Football And No. 94
• In 1994, NC State football head coach Dave Doeren embarked on his career path by being an assistant coach at Shawnee Mission North High in Overland Park, Kan. A year later, Doeren got started in the college ranks, beginning a three-year stint at his alma mater Drake, where he coached linebackers and added the title of defensive coordinator in 1997.
• The 1994 team at NC State was the best during head coach Mike O’Cain’s tenure. The Pack spent 10 weeks ranked in the Associated Press top 25 poll, including 17th in the final edition after defeating No. 16 Mississippi State, 28-24, in the Peach Bowl on New Year’s Day.
NC State finished the year 9-3 overall and went 6-2 in the ACC. Along with the bowl victory, the Wolfpack also scored ranked wins over Clemson and Virginia on the road and Duke at home.
That team, led by quarterback Terry Harvey and a promising freshman running back named Tremayne Stephens, started the year 4-0, including the aforementioned win over No. 22 Clemson. A brief slump of losing 2 of 3 games, both by multiple touchdowns with one to ranked archrival North Carolina, slowed the season’s momentum, but NC State rebounded to win 4 of 5 to end the year, losing only to No. 8 Florida State during that stretch.

Unfortunately for O’Cain, the next two years resulted in just three wins each campaign, and he never won more than seven games in a season again before being fired following the 1999 campaign. He finished his NC State tenure with an overall record of 41-40.
• The first time that NC State football officially played North Carolina was in 1894. The results did not go well. In two games, UNC outscored the Wolfpack by a combined 50-0. Those were the only two games for NC State football that season.
North Carolina leads the all-time series against NC State, 68-38-6, but that lopsided margin was piled up during the pre-ACC days. From 1894-1952, North Carolina went 31-5-6. The ACC started in 1953, and since then the Heels’ advantage over NC State is 37-33. The Pack is 14-9 against UNC since 2000.
Doeren is 6-4 against the Heels.
